preliminary resources
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"preliminary resources"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when referring to initial or introductory materials or tools that are needed for a project or research. Example: "Before we begin the main research, let's gather some preliminary resources to help us understand the topic better."

Linguistic Context
The phrase "preliminary resources" functions as a noun phrase, where "preliminary" acts as an adjective modifying the noun "resources". It is used to describe the type of resources that are initial or preparatory in nature.

More alternative expressions(10)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
initial resources
Replaces "preliminary" with "initial", emphasizing the starting point of resource gathering.
introductory resources
Substitutes "preliminary" with "introductory", highlighting the resources as an introduction to a topic or project.
preparatory materials
Replaces "resources" with "materials", focusing on physical or digital items used for preparation.
foundational resources
Emphasizes that the resources provide a base or foundation for further work.
early-stage resources
Highlights the resources as being relevant to the early stages of a project or process.
developmental resources
Suggests the resources are for building or developing something.
pilot resources
Implies the resources are used in a test or trial phase.
proto-resources
Uses "proto-" to indicate the earliest form of resources.
seed resources
Suggests that the resources are small or initial, like seeds, that will grow into something larger.
basic resources
Emphasizes the resources are fundamental and essential.
FAQs
How can I effectively use "preliminary resources" in a project?
"Preliminary resources" should be used to gain a foundational understanding of the topic before moving on to more advanced research or tasks. Start with broad overviews and gradually narrow your focus.
What are some alternatives to using the phrase "preliminary resources"?
You can use alternatives like "initial resources", "introductory materials", or "foundational resources" depending on the context.
What kind of materials are typically considered "preliminary resources"?
"Preliminary resources" can include textbooks, introductory articles, online tutorials, and any other materials that provide a basic overview of the topic.
When is it appropriate to use the term "preliminary resources" in academic writing?
It's appropriate to use the term "preliminary resources" when discussing the initial stages of research or project development, particularly when outlining the materials used to gain a basic understanding of the subject matter.
